diff options
author | Max Krummenacher <max.krummenacher@toradex.com> | 2020-06-18 18:21:16 +0200 |
---|---|---|
committer | Max Krummenacher <max.krummenacher@toradex.com> | 2020-06-22 17:13:10 +0200 |
commit | 0ea6166c6cec5f792992e122393a7a894a991d4b (patch) | |
tree | 7fd5a51eec437b41afd9c3d9401ba682ef80ce54 |
initial commit
This unifies and replaces the following manifests
starting from version 5.x.y:
http://git.toradex.com/toradex-bsp-platform.git
https://github.com/toradex/toradex-torizon-manifest.git
Related-to: ELB-2755
Signed-off-by: Max Krummenacher <max.krummenacher@toradex.com>
-rw-r--r-- | README.md | 16 | ||||
-rw-r--r-- | base/integration.xml | 12 | ||||
-rw-r--r-- | base/pinned.xml | 12 | ||||
-rw-r--r-- | bsp/integration-nxp.xml | 8 | ||||
-rw-r--r-- | bsp/integration-tdx.xml | 8 | ||||
-rw-r--r-- | bsp/pinned-nxp.xml | 8 | ||||
-rw-r--r-- | bsp/pinned-tdx.xml | 7 | ||||
-rw-r--r-- | tdxref/default.xml | 11 | ||||
-rw-r--r-- | tdxref/integration.xml | 11 | ||||
-rw-r--r-- | tdxref/next.xml | 11 | ||||
-rw-r--r-- | torizoncore/default.xml | 19 | ||||
-rw-r--r-- | torizoncore/integration.xml | 19 | ||||
-rw-r--r-- | torizoncore/next.xml | 19 |
13 files changed, 161 insertions, 0 deletions
diff --git a/README.md b/README.md new file mode 100644 index 0000000..9b4c6e5 --- /dev/null +++ b/README.md @@ -0,0 +1,16 @@ +# Toradex oe-core Setup + +To simplify installation we provide a manifest for the repo tool which manages +the different git repositories and the used versions. +[more on repo](https://code.google.com/p/git-repo/) + +This manifest allows setting up TorizonCore or Toradex Reference Images. + +## Getting Started and Documentation TorizonCore + +- [Step-by-step Getting Started Guide](https://developer.toradex.com/getting-started) +- [Torizon Software Page](https://developer.toradex.com/software/torizon) + +## Getting Started and Documentation Reference Images + +- [OpenEmbedded (core)](https://developer.toradex.com/knowledge-base/board-support-package/openembedded-(core)) diff --git a/base/integration.xml b/base/integration.xml new file mode 100644 index 0000000..be3c9c5 --- /dev/null +++ b/base/integration.xml @@ -0,0 +1,12 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://github.com/openembedded" name="oe"/> + <remote alias="repo" fetch="https://git.yoctoproject.org/git" name="yocto"/> + + <default sync-j="4"/> + + <project name="bitbake.git" path="layers/openembedded-core/bitbake" remote="oe" revision="master"/> + <project name="meta-openembedded.git" path="layers/meta-openembedded" remote="oe" revision="master"/> + <project name="meta-yocto" path="layers/meta-yocto" remote="yocto" revision="master"/> + <project name="openembedded-core.git" path="layers/openembedded-core" remote="oe" revision="master"/> +</manifest> diff --git a/base/pinned.xml b/base/pinned.xml new file mode 100644 index 0000000..8bcea4a --- /dev/null +++ b/base/pinned.xml @@ -0,0 +1,12 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://github.com/openembedded" name="oe"/> + <remote alias="repo" fetch="https://git.yoctoproject.org/git" name="yocto"/> + + <default sync-j="4"/> + + <project name="bitbake.git" path="layers/openembedded-core/bitbake" remote="oe" revision="b94dec477a8d48ebceec91952ba290798c56c1f5" upstream="master"/> + <project name="meta-openembedded.git" path="layers/meta-openembedded" remote="oe" revision="679bb4912613f3860e8527557602251e5e5f2c41" upstream="master"/> + <project name="meta-yocto" path="layers/meta-yocto" remote="yocto" revision="3f6857be9be9ab5e2ede9a416c212487357eec0d" upstream="master"/> + <project name="openembedded-core.git" path="layers/openembedded-core" remote="oe" revision="1795f30d8ab73d35710ca99064c51190dc84853e" upstream="master"/> +</manifest> diff --git a/bsp/integration-nxp.xml b/bsp/integration-nxp.xml new file mode 100644 index 0000000..da1ccda --- /dev/null +++ b/bsp/integration-nxp.xml @@ -0,0 +1,8 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://github.com/Freescale" name="githf"/> + + <project name="meta-freescale-3rdparty.git" path="layers/meta-freescale-3rdparty" remote="githf" revision="master"/> + <project name="meta-freescale-distro.git" path="layers/meta-freescale-distro" remote="githf" revision="master"/> + <project name="meta-freescale.git" path="layers/meta-freescale" remote="githf" revision="master"/> +</manifest> diff --git a/bsp/integration-tdx.xml b/bsp/integration-tdx.xml new file mode 100644 index 0000000..6f63c53 --- /dev/null +++ b/bsp/integration-tdx.xml @@ -0,0 +1,8 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://git.toradex.com" name="tdx"/> + + <project name="meta-toradex-bsp-common.git" path="layers/meta-toradex-bsp-common" remote="tdx" revision="master"/> + <project name="meta-toradex-nxp.git" path="layers/meta-toradex-nxp" remote="tdx" revision="master"/> + <project name="meta-toradex-tegra.git" path="layers/meta-toradex-tegra" remote="tdx" revision="master"/> +</manifest> diff --git a/bsp/pinned-nxp.xml b/bsp/pinned-nxp.xml new file mode 100644 index 0000000..21ac49e --- /dev/null +++ b/bsp/pinned-nxp.xml @@ -0,0 +1,8 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://github.com/Freescale" name="githf"/> + + <project name="meta-freescale-3rdparty.git" path="layers/meta-freescale-3rdparty" remote="githf" revision="f57de4d2d9b9cd342e0d01fd1b15be3e842ccd34" upstream="master"/> + <project name="meta-freescale-distro.git" path="layers/meta-freescale-distro" remote="githf" revision="eb60ca80e81e07909920889fcdd03649934c4896" upstream="master"/> + <project name="meta-freescale.git" path="layers/meta-freescale" remote="githf" revision="e1b169c907b2d6743f277f1212fcc6ecb2e068c3" upstream="master"/> +</manifest> diff --git a/bsp/pinned-tdx.xml b/bsp/pinned-tdx.xml new file mode 100644 index 0000000..84a6a20 --- /dev/null +++ b/bsp/pinned-tdx.xml @@ -0,0 +1,7 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<remote alias="repo" fetch="https://git.toradex.com" name="tdx"/> + <project name="meta-toradex-bsp-common.git" path="layers/meta-toradex-bsp-common" remote="tdx" revision="c6044060a69d468e23512a399c7a3549a3e09bf1" upstream="zeus"/> + <project name="meta-toradex-nxp.git" path="layers/meta-toradex-nxp" remote="tdx" revision="f74c7864926f9e40087a84f3df7675f041702e3a" upstream="zeus"/> + <project name="meta-toradex-tegra.git" path="layers/meta-toradex-tegra" remote="tdx" revision="a16c8deb744f8b563ff111d3f4219924715b3f48" upstream="zeus"/> +</manifest> diff --git a/tdxref/default.xml b/tdxref/default.xml new file mode 100644 index 0000000..40f707e --- /dev/null +++ b/tdxref/default.xml @@ -0,0 +1,11 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/pinned.xml" /> + <include name="bsp/pinned-nxp.xml" /> + <include name="bsp/pinned-tdx.xml" /> + + <project name="meta-toradex-demos.git" path="layers/meta-toradex-demos" remote="tdx" revision="c1eb6842f5407f7d3d09443538eef6afe36b92e8" upstream="master"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="e3f94773b8c89097964b6aad19e7d2dd1fcf0a3f" upstream="master"> + <copyfile dest="export" src="buildconf/export"/> + </project> +</manifest> diff --git a/tdxref/integration.xml b/tdxref/integration.xml new file mode 100644 index 0000000..7440a05 --- /dev/null +++ b/tdxref/integration.xml @@ -0,0 +1,11 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/pinned.xml" /> + <include name="bsp/pinned-nxp.xml" /> + <include name="bsp/integration-tdx.xml" /> + + <project name="meta-toradex-demos.git" path="layers/meta-toradex-demos" remote="tdx" revision="master"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="master"> + <copyfile dest="export" src="buildconf/export"/> + </project> +</manifest> diff --git a/tdxref/next.xml b/tdxref/next.xml new file mode 100644 index 0000000..41e1c73 --- /dev/null +++ b/tdxref/next.xml @@ -0,0 +1,11 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/integration.xml" /> + <include name="bsp/integration-nxp.xml" /> + <include name="bsp/integration-tdx.xml" /> + + <project name="meta-toradex-demos.git" path="layers/meta-toradex-demos" remote="tdx" revision="master"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="master"> + <copyfile dest="export" src="buildconf/export"/> + </project> +</manifest> diff --git a/torizoncore/default.xml b/torizoncore/default.xml new file mode 100644 index 0000000..e8f4691 --- /dev/null +++ b/torizoncore/default.xml @@ -0,0 +1,19 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/pinned.xml" /> + <include name="bsp/pinned-nxp.xml" /> + <include name="bsp/pinned-tdx.xml" /> + + <remote fetch="https://github.com/advancedtelematic" name="ats"/> + <remote fetch="https://github.com/toradex" name="toradex-torizon"/> + <remote fetch="https://github.com/foundriesio" name="foundriesio"/> + + <project name="meta-lmp" path="layers/meta-lmp" remote="foundriesio" revision="3f8596beab50fd502b911426f3cec70d38ff7c51"/> + <project name="meta-security" path="layers/meta-security" remote="yocto" revision="98a6664408f17560549b94f575e058ed84dd6a0d"/> + <project name="meta-updater" path="layers/meta-updater" remote="ats" revision="177081df3a793ee0e028b33bd416cdff97eee471"/> + <project name="meta-virtualization" path="layers/meta-virtualization" remote="yocto" revision="2bba10be28d4d7ce45d78a8429caaa6952785901"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="e5fc1a70e0ba72fb15d6a7d0baac0cee035a200c"/> + <project name="meta-toradex-torizon" path="layers/meta-toradex-torizon" remote="toradex-torizon" revision="cf657f20f749955e78a02fa37b157630fcb2425a"> + <linkfile dest="setup-environment" src="scripts/setup-environment"/> + </project> +</manifest> diff --git a/torizoncore/integration.xml b/torizoncore/integration.xml new file mode 100644 index 0000000..6f31c0c --- /dev/null +++ b/torizoncore/integration.xml @@ -0,0 +1,19 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/pinned.xml" /> + <include name="bsp/pinned-nxp.xml" /> + <include name="bsp/integration-tdx.xml" /> + + <remote fetch="https://github.com/advancedtelematic" name="ats"/> + <remote fetch="https://github.com/toradex" name="toradex-torizon"/> + <remote fetch="https://github.com/foundriesio" name="foundriesio"/> + + <project name="meta-lmp" path="layers/meta-lmp" remote="foundriesio" revision="3f8596beab50fd502b911426f3cec70d38ff7c51"/> + <project name="meta-security" path="layers/meta-security" remote="yocto" revision="98a6664408f17560549b94f575e058ed84dd6a0d"/> + <project name="meta-updater" path="layers/meta-updater" remote="ats" revision="177081df3a793ee0e028b33bd416cdff97eee471"/> + <project name="meta-virtualization" path="layers/meta-virtualization" remote="yocto" revision="2bba10be28d4d7ce45d78a8429caaa6952785901"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="master"/> + <project name="meta-toradex-torizon" path="layers/meta-toradex-torizon" remote="toradex-torizon" revision="master"> + <linkfile dest="setup-environment" src="scripts/setup-environment"/> + </project> +</manifest> diff --git a/torizoncore/next.xml b/torizoncore/next.xml new file mode 100644 index 0000000..a3fe214 --- /dev/null +++ b/torizoncore/next.xml @@ -0,0 +1,19 @@ +<?xml version="1.0" encoding="UTF-8"?> +<manifest> + <include name="base/integration.xml" /> + <include name="bsp/integration-nxp.xml" /> + <include name="bsp/integration-tdx.xml" /> + + <remote fetch="https://github.com/advancedtelematic" name="ats"/> + <remote fetch="https://github.com/toradex" name="toradex-torizon"/> + <remote fetch="https://github.com/foundriesio" name="foundriesio"/> + + <project name="meta-lmp" path="layers/meta-lmp" remote="foundriesio" revision="master"/> + <project name="meta-security" path="layers/meta-security" remote="yocto" revision="master"/> + <project name="meta-updater" path="layers/meta-updater" remote="ats" revision="master"/> + <project name="meta-virtualization" path="layers/meta-virtualization" remote="yocto" revision="master"/> + <project name="meta-toradex-distro.git" path="layers/meta-toradex-distro" remote="tdx" revision="master"/> + <project name="meta-toradex-torizon" path="layers/meta-toradex-torizon" remote="toradex-torizon" revision="master"> + <linkfile dest="setup-environment" src="scripts/setup-environment"/> + </project> +</manifest> |